15 U.S.C. § 77b1 - Swap agreements

Text

(a) [Reserved]

(b) Security-based swap agreements (1) The definition of “security” in section 77b(a)(1) of this title does not include any security-based swap agreement (as defined in section 78c(a)(78) of this title).

(2) The Commission is prohibited from registering, or requiring, recommending, or suggesting, the registration under this subchapter of any security-based swap agreement (as defined in section 78c(a)(78) of this title). If the Commission becomes aware that a registrant has filed a registration statement with respect to such a swap agreement, the Commission shall promptly so notify the registrant. Any such registration statement with respect to such a swap agreement shall be void and of no force or effect.

(3) The Commission is prohibited from—

(A) promulgating, interpreting, or enforcing rules; or

(B) issuing orders of general applicability;

under this subchapter in a manner that imposes or specifies reporting or recordkeeping requirements, procedures, or standards as prophylactic measures against fraud, manipulation, or insider trading with respect to any security-based swap agreement (as defined in section 78c(a)(78) of this title).

(4) References in this subchapter to the “purchase” or “sale” of a security-based swap agreement shall be deemed to mean the execution, termination (prior to its scheduled maturity date), assignment, exchange, or similar transfer or conveyance of, or extinguishing of rights or obligations under, a security-based swap agreement (as defined in section 78c(a)(78) of this title), as the context may require.

(May 27, 1933, ch. 38, title I, § 2A, as added Pub. L. 106554, § 1(a)(5) [title III, § 302(a)], Dec. 21, 2000, 114 Stat. 2763, 2763A451; amended Pub. L. 111203, title VII, § 762(c)(1), July 21, 2010, 124 Stat. 1759.)

Notes

Editorial Notes

Amendments2010—Subsec. (a). Pub. L. 111203, § 762(c)(1)(A), struck out subsec. (a) and reserved subsec. (a) designation. Text read as follows: “The definition of security in section 77b(a)(1) of this title does not include any non-security-based swap agreement (as defined in section 206C of the Gramm-Leach-Bliley Act).” Subsec. (b). Pub. L. 111203, § 762(c)(1)(B), substituted “(as defined in section 78c(a)(78) of this title)” for “(as defined in section 206B of the Gramm-Leach-Bliley Act)” wherever appearing.

Statutory Notes and Related Subsidiaries

Effective Date of 2010 AmendmentAmendment by Pub. L. 111203 effective on the later of 360 days after July 21, 2010, or, to the extent a provision of subtitle B (§§ 761774) of title VII of Pub. L. 111203 requires a rulemaking, not less than 60 days after publication of the final rule or regulation implementing such provision of subtitle B, see section 774 of Pub. L. 111203, set out as a note under section 77b of this title.
